Abstract:
The purpose of this paper is to provide a model for educators involved in teaching interrelated ethical, moral and legal dilemmas confronting health care delivery. For purposes of discussion, the AIDS epidemic is used as an example. Similarly complex issues, such as invitro fertilization, transplantation policy, etc. could also be analyzed using this model. A review of federal law, including a number of relevant cases, and their relationship of fundamental ethics issues is provided.
